In celebration of World Tree Planting Day and in recognition of residents at Kinross and Lewis Hall, two trees were planted on the grounds of Parkland at the Lakes, a retirement living community in Dartmouth, N.S. This initiative is part of a partnership between the Clean Foundation’s Thriving Forests Program to plant trees at three of our Nova Scotia locations: Parkland at the Lakes in Dartmouth, Parkland Cape Breton, and Parkland Truro. Each site was evaluated to ensure suitability for planting, including local wildlife, slope, and soil composition resulting in the planting of just under 6,000 trees. Many of our communities are blessed with beautiful scenery and land, making it an easy choice for Shannex to partner with the Province of Nova Scotia and the Clean Foundation to help reach their goal of planting 21 million trees and Canada’s goal of two billion trees by 2031.
